The cheapest way to get from Dihua Street to Taipei 101 is to subway which costs $1 and takes 19 min.
The fastest way to get from Dihua Street to Taipei 101 is to taxi which takes 9 min and costs $9 - $12.
No, there is no direct bus from Dihua Street station to Taipei 101 station. However, there are services departing from MRT Daqiaotou Station and arriving at Taipei City Hall Bus Station via Taipei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 30 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Minquan West Road and arriving at Taipei 101 World Trade Center.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 16 min.
The distance between Dihua Street and Taipei 101 is 9 km.
The best way to get from Dihua Street to Taipei 101 without a car is to subway which takes 19 min and costs $1.
The subway from Minquan West Road to Taipei 101 World Trade Center takes 16 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
